| 17 | /* |
| 18 | * scalbnl (long double x, int n) |
| 19 | * scalbnl(x,n) returns x* 2**n computed by exponent |
| 20 | * manipulation rather than by actually performing an |
| 21 | * exponentiation or a multiplication. |
| 22 | */ |
| 23 | |
| 24 | /* |
| 25 | * We assume that a long double has a 15-bit exponent. On systems |
| 26 | * where long double is the same as double, scalbnl() is an alias |
| 27 | * for scalbn(), so we don't use this routine. |
| 28 | */ |

| 40 | static const long double |
| 41 | huge = 0x1p16000L, |
| 42 | tiny = 0x1p-16000L; |
| 43 | |
| 44 | long double |
| 45 | scalbnl (long double x, int n) |
| 46 | { |
| 47 | union IEEEl2bits u; |
| 48 | int k; |
| 49 | u.e = x; |
| 50 | k = u.bits.exp; /* extract exponent */ |
| 51 | if (k==0) { /* 0 or subnormal x */ |
| 52 | if ((u.bits.manh|u.bits.manl)==0) return x; /* +-0 */ |
| 53 | u.e *= 0x1p+128; |
| 54 | k = u.bits.exp - 128; |
| 55 | if (n< -50000) return tiny*x; /*underflow*/ |
| 56 | } |
| 57 | if (k==0x7fff) return x+x; /* NaN or Inf */ |
| 58 | k = k+n; |
| 59 | if (k >= 0x7fff) return huge*copysignl(huge,x); /* overflow */ |
| 60 | if (k > 0) /* normal result */ |
| 61 | {u.bits.exp = k; return u.e;} |
| 62 | if (k <= -128) |
| 63 | if (n > 50000) /* in case integer overflow in n+k */ |
| 64 | return huge*copysign(huge,x); /*overflow*/ |
| 65 | else return tiny*copysign(tiny,x); /*underflow*/ |
| 66 | k += 128; /* subnormal result */ |
| 67 | u.bits.exp = k; |
| 68 | return u.e*0x1p-128; |
| 69 | } |
